Summary

The serious practitioner of the martial arts will have learned from this book that weight, speed, focus, penetration and concentration are essential cornerstones to the mastery of breaking techniques. To use them effectively, they must be coordinated into a working unit. Your body thus

becomes an efficient, deadly machine. To accomplish this goal, you must be in the best physical condition. You must have flexibility. Work on one element at a time. Start with focus, add concentration, then penetration. Put your weight into what you're doing. When your accuracy is carefully developed, add speed.

The key to success in breaking techniques is similar to any other of the arts-practice. To practice well requires dedication. With all of these elements going for you, you should have developed a well-coordinated technique. Use it to keep in shape. Use it.
